    Case Summary: WP(C)/2855/2026 Shri Uttam Das v. The State of Assam & Others The Gauhati High Court issued a notice on the writ petition filed by Shri Uttam Das against the State of Assam and various Public Health Engineering Department officials. The court ordered the matter to be adjourned, with notices returnable within four weeks. Since all respondents were represented and accepted notice, formal notice service was waived, but petitioner's counsel must furnish extra copies within one week.
